    EU diplomats are considering a boycott of the 2018 Fifa World Cup in Russia, as part of the retaliation measures connected with Russia's alleged role in Ukraine. According to a report in The Financial Times, a document detailing options for future penalties against Russia, circulated in European capitals on Sept. ...

    Patagonia has published its Environmental & Social Initiatives 2014 book, which reveals the company donated $6.6 million to environmental groups worldwide during fiscal year 2014. The full list of grant recipients is available in Patagonia's “Environment and Social Initiatives” book. In addition to philanthropy, among the various other initiatives presented ...

    Björn Borg's net income declined by 35.3 percent to 2.2 million Swedish kronor (€0.24m-$0.31m) in the second quarter ended June 30. The gross margin improved slightly to 52.5 percent but sales fell by 8 percent to SEK 97 million (€10.57m-$13.88m), and they were down by 10 percent in local currencies. For ...

    Descente has reported a 16.3 percent sales increase to 23.4 billion yen (€171.26m-$224.91m) for the first fiscal quarter of its financial year, ended on June 30, with a big increase in Athletic Wear offsetting slight declines in the Golf and Outdoor segments.  Strong performance by Arena swimwear helped to lift sales ...

    Nautilus reported a net profit of $557,000 for the seasonally slow second quarter of its fiscal year, ended June 30, which compares with a net profit of $32,863,000 made in the year-ago period thanks to a tax benefit of $34.3 million. The American fitness equipment supplier posted an operating profit ...
